Size:  124.1 KBGood day on Kaw earlier this week. Kept 21 fish over 1 pound, only 2 shorts the whole day. 16 of them were over 1.25Lbs. Top 7 fish weighed 13.88 Lbs. Had three that were 2+ Lbs. It was not easy fishing, had to grind it out, but it was rewarding if you could fish slow. Fish were from 8-18 feet deep. Used 1/4 TT jigs with various baits. It was more about presentation than color or style-- just getting it front of them and holding it there UNTIL they bit.

    Ran the long poles today 19 to 22 fow fishing 12 to 17 ft deep. Caught some good fish under shad schools. Wind was tough today had to stay on trolling motor. Water temp was 44 deg and murky. Big fish was 15 1/4 inches. Didn't weigh any but had some 2 plus lbs. Missed a lot of fish because of wind blowing boat around.

    Caught some footballs today. About as wide as they were long. Had to push double minnows rigs into brush piles on spider rig to catch them. Shad had to be close by to get bites. Ended up with 20 nice fish in about 3 hours. Water temp went up to 48 this afternoon. Lot of people on the water and they were moving a lot. Most were fishing where they normally do this time of year and were having a tough day.
